New pets on Valentine's Day��kissing fish

www.chinanews.cn 2005-02-16 14:53:47

On Feb 14, 2005, kissing fish, known for kissing, appeared in the market
in an aquarium in Nanjing, Jiangsu Province. Many young people rushed to
buy them as special gifts for this year's Valentine's Day. It was said
that kissing fish would make the sound of "pada" when kissing,
symbolizing long-lasting love and affection. Giving a pair of kissing
fish to your partner is considered special on Valentine's Day.
